Ticket: Admin bulk-edit blocked by sealed vault

New folks: bulk edits in the Marlow admin table require a signing key held in Fernvault. The vault sealed after last night's restart, so all bulk operations currently fail with a permissions error. Single-row edits still work. Anyone on rotation can unseal it by entering the recovery passphrase below.

recovery phrase for bawep-kawef: oliath-casdor

### Changed

Renamed the Parcelo webhook signing setting to match our naming convention — old name still works but warns. Reviewers: check that any sample env files in docs use the new name. Functionally nothing changed; same HMAC scheme. The signing secret itself should sit on the line right after this one.

vault entry, yahif-yajep: COURIER_KEY29=b802bdf8034096b65a51c6ba5abe2

Handover — Vexler partner SFTP drop

Ownership moves to you today. Drop runs hourly from Vexler's end into the intake bucket via the relay host. Watch for zero-byte files; their exporter flakes on Mondays. Creds live in the ops vault, path noted in the runbook. Vault auto-seals after 48h idle. Support escalations go to the on-call rotation, not me. If the vault is sealed when you need it, unseal with the recovery passphrase below.

recovery phrase for tadug-fafof: zorwyn-kasion

For security review: the Pickwise optimizer in the Harlowe warehouse env was shipped with the staging credential baked into the image — that's the misconfig. We've rotated it and moved config out of the image entirely. Remaining step is to provision the runtime secret properly. On the optimizer host, the .env should contain exactly this line:

vault entry, yahaf-tagug: LEDGER_TOKEN20=884d77d1a8b98aa4edfb

- [ ] Step 7: Archive cold storage buckets (Glacierline tier). Confirm both ceremony witnesses are present, verify bucket manifests match the Oxbow ledger, then seal the archive key shares. Plugin authors may observe but not handle shares. Once sealed, the archive index itself is encrypted and can only be reopened with the passphrase below.

vault phrase of badup-hahig = tamael-aldael-kelmir-istael-fenok-istwyn-tamius-jorath-oliion